I had one that one of the plastic around the outlet opening was switched the wrong way. I believe they installed the round black piece the wrong way so the opening for the polarized plug would not fit right. I had to get a new one because the usb didnt work on it. If you unplug it see if you can take off the black cover over the opening to see if you can put them on the right way. The whole thing just plugs into a normal outlet under the counter or in the kitchen table. BTW the polarized plug has an opening on the left that is bigger than the right. The top one in the picture is put on the wrong way.

They are screwed on. Take out the top drawer under the outlet. The drawer will release if you push up on the little plastic keeper on one side and push it down on the other side. Then unscrew the unit. it is simply plugged into another outlet below the counter. You can then put a small electrical strip through the hole until you get a replacement from the factory or amazon.
